King Richard alone was killed fighting manfully in the thickest press of his enemies. Fifteenth-century England saw the turmoil of a bloody struggle for power between the House of York and the House of Lancaster, known to history as the Wars of the Roses. It would culminate in a ferocious encounter on Bosworth Field in 1485, a battle which saw the death of King Richard III. With Henry VII's victory, so the Tudor dynasty was born.
